Newcastle SRC elections

By Shane Bentley

NEWCASTLE -- The progressive “Activate” ticket breathed some life into elections for the Newcastle University Students Representative Council, held April 18-21.

Activate won four out of five contested executive positions with an average 60% of the vote. Its main opposition was the Liberal-backed “Students for Students”.

Activate stands for greater student involvement in the Student Association; a better deal from the University Union; a student bill of rights for quality education; improved safety, child-care and student accommodation; improving university waste minimisation; working within the National Union of Students to pressure the federal government to change its education policies.

Previous SRCs have been dominated by Labor students. This election result should provide an opening for students to become involved in a range of campaigns and actions.
